ByteDance DeerFlow 2.0: 샌드박스 및 메모리 기반 오픈소스 슈퍼 에이전트 프레임워크

DeerFlow는 ByteDance에서 오픈소스로 공개한 SuperAgent 오케스트레이션 프레임워크로, 복잡하고 장기적인 작업에서 AI 능력의 파편화와 예측 불가 문제를 해결하기 위해 설계되었습니다. Deep Research의 진화형인 DeerFlow 2.0은 하위 에이전트, 장기 메모리, 샌드박스 환경, 확장 가능한 스킬 시스템을 통합한 새로운 아키텍처를 도입하여 단순 쿼리부터 수시간에 걸친 딥 리서치까지 자동화를 실현합니다. 핵심 차별점은 메시지 게이트웨이와 모듈형 스킬 메커니즘을 통해 코드 생성, 심층 탐색, 다단계 추론 작업을 원활하게 오케스트레이션할 수 있다는 점입니다. 높은 신뢰성과 추적성이 요구되는 연구개발 및 데이터 분석 시나리오를 위해 설계되었으며, 개발자에게 프로덕션 준비 완료 에이전트 인프라를 제공합니다.

배경

인공지능 애플리케이션이 단순한 대화형 인터페이스에서 복잡한 자동화 워크플로우로 진화함에 따라, 다중 AI 에이전트를 효율적으로 조정하여 장기적인 작업을 수행하는 방법은 업계의 핵심 과제로 부상했습니다. ByteDance에서 오픈소스로 공개한 DeerFlow 2.0은 '슈퍼 에이전트 오케스트레이션 프레임워크'로 정의되며, 기존 Deep Research의 기능을 확장하여 단순한 정보 수집을 넘어선 복잡한 다단계 추론 작업을 처리할 수 있는 범용 인프라로 재탄생했습니다. 이 프레임워크는 경량급 에이전트 라이브러리와 무거운 엔터프라이즈 워크플로우 엔진 사이의 간극을 메우는 중간 계층에 위치하며, 다중 모델 호출, 상태 관리, 환경 격리 등의 하위 복잡성을 추상화하여 개발자가 고수준의 작업 로직에 집중할 수 있도록 합니다.

DeerFlow 2.0은 GitHub 트렌드 차트에서 빠르게 상위권을 차지하며 오픈소스 커뮤니티의 큰 주목을 받고 있습니다. 이는 개발자들이 단순한 오케스트레이션을 넘어 신뢰성, 추적성, 그리고 장기적인 작업 수명 동안 일관성을 유지할 수 있는 에이전트 프레임워크에 대한 강한 수요를 반영합니다. 기존 프레임워크들이 경험했던 상태 관리 실패, 컨텍스트 손실, 그리고 외부 환경과의 안전한 상호작용 불가능 등의 한계를 해결함으로써, DeerFlow 2.0은 프로덕션 환경에서 신뢰할 수 있는 자율형 AI 애플리케이션을 구축하기 위한 표준화된 접근 방식을 제시하고 있습니다.

심층 분석

DeerFlow 2.0의 아키텍처 핵심은 하위 에이전트(Sub-agents), 장기 메모리(Long-term Memory), 샌드박스 환경, 그리고 확장 가능한 스킬 시스템(Skills System)의 통합에 기반합니다. 이 프레임워크의 가장 큰 차별점은 메시지 게이트웨이(Message Gateway)와 모듈형 스킬 메커니즘을 도입하여 코드 생성, 심층 탐색, 다단계 추론 작업 등을 원활하게 오케스트레이션할 수 있다는 점입니다. 개발자는 플러그인 기반 아키텍처를 통해 Claude Code와 같은 고급 코딩 도구를 통합할 수 있으며, 이는 에이전트의 자율적인 코드 생성, 실행, 디버깅 능력을 크게 향상시킵니다. 이러한 확장성은 시스템의 전체적인 재설계 없이도 새로운 도구와 기능에 적응할 수 있게 하여, 진화하는 사용 사례에 유연한 기반을 제공합니다.

안전성과 신뢰성을 보장하기 위해 DeerFlow 2.0은 엄격한 샌드박스 및 파일 시스템 메커니즘을 활용합니다. 이 격리된 실행 환경은 AI 모델이 호스트 시스템을 오염시키거나 악성 코드를 실행하는 것을 방지하며, 모델의 환각(Hallucination)이나 예기치 않은 동작으로 인한 위험을 최소화합니다. 또한, 프레임워크는 고급 컨텍스트 엔지니어링과 장기 메모리 기술을 통합하여, 에이전트가 수시간에 걸친 작업 주기 동안에도 일관성을 유지하고 관련 정보를 검색할 수 있도록 합니다. 이는 유한한 컨텍스트 윈도우의 한계를 극복하는 데 필수적이며, 특히 연속적인 추론 스레드가 정확성과 완전성을 위해 중요한 심층 연구 및 복잡한 데이터 분석 작업에서 결정적인 역할을 합니다.

하위 에이전트 아키텍처는 DeerFlow 2.0의 성능을 더욱 강화하여 병렬 처리와 전문화된 작업 위임을 가능하게 합니다. 복잡한 목표는 작고 관리 가능한 하위 작업으로 분해되어 특정 기능에 최적화된 전용 하위 에이전트에 할당됩니다. 이러한 분업은 효율성뿐만 아니라 최종 출력의 신뢰성도 향상시키며, 각 하위 에이전트는 특정 전문 지식을 위해 미세 조정되거나 선택될 수 있습니다. 이러한 구성 요소의 통합은 이전 세대의 에이전트 프레임워크가 달성할 수 없었던 정밀도와 자율성 수준으로 장기 작업의 복잡성을 처리할 수 있는 견고한 파이프라인을 만듭니다.

산업 영향

DeerFlow 2.0의 오픈소스 공개는 워크플로우 오케스트레이션과 에이전트 표준화 분야에서 광범위한 AI 개발 커뮤니티에 중대한 영향을 미칩니다. 프로덕션 준비가 완료된 인프라를 즉시 제공함으로써, 이 프레임워크는 정교한 AI 애플리케이션 구축의 진입 장벽을 낮춥니다. 개발자들은 더 이상 상태 관리, 메모리 지속성, 환경 격리와 같은 오류가 발생하기 쉽고 시간이 많이 소요되는 작업을 자체적으로 구축할 필요가 없게 되었습니다. 대신, DeerFlow 2.0의 검증된 아키텍처를 활용하여 도메인별 로직과 사용자 경험에 집중할 수 있습니다. 이는 신뢰성과 보안이 최우선인 엔터프라이즈 환경에서 AI 에이전트의 채택을 가속화합니다.

프레임워크의 배포 옵션 유연성 또한 그 산업적 영향력을 높이는 요인입니다. 개발자는 로컬 디버깅을 위한 간단한 원커맨드 시작부터 프로덕션 환경을 위한 Docker 기반 배포까지 선택할 수 있습니다. 임베디드 Python 클라이언트, 터미널 사용자 인터페이스(TUI), 그리고 메시지 게이트웨이를 통한 인스턴트 메시징 소프트웨어 연결을 지원함으로써, DeerFlow 2.0은 다양한 운영 컨텍스트에 적합합니다. 이는 자동화된 코드 검토, 심층 시장 연구, 복잡한 데이터 분석 워크플로우 등 다양한 사용 사례에 적합함을 의미합니다. LangSmith 및 Langfuse와 같은 인기 모니터링 도구와의 호환성은 기존 DevOps 및 MLOps 파이프라인에 원활하게 통합될 수 있게 하여 프레임워크의 매력을 더합니다.

또한, DeerFlow 2.0은 에이전트 보안과 책임 있는 AI 개발을 위한 새로운 벤치마크를 설정합니다. 샌드박싱과 엄격한 보안 프로토콜의 중요성을 강조함으로써, 이 프레임워크는 자율형 에이전트 관리에 대한 모범 사례를 개발자들에게 교육합니다. AI 에이전트가 실제 세계의 결과를 초래할 수 있는 행동을 수행할 수 있을 정도로 강력하고 자율적으로 진화함에 따라, 이러한 안전에 대한 초점은 매우 중요합니다. 추적성과 감사 가능성에 대한 강조는 다른 개발자들이 따를 수 있는 모델을 제공하며, AI 개발에서 투명성과 책임감의 문화를 장려합니다.

전망

향후 DeerFlow 2.0은 에이전트 오케스트레이션 프레임워크로서의 입지를 더욱 공고히 할 여러 주요 방향으로 진화할 것으로 예상됩니다. 예상되는 개발 분야 중 하나는 에이전트 간 협업 프로토콜의 강화로, 에이전트가 협상하고 지식을 공유하며 더 높은 자율성으로 복잡한 작업을 조정할 수 있는 정교한 다중 에이전트 시스템을 가능하게 할 것입니다. 또한, 프레임워크는 더 세분화된 권한 제어(Granular Permission Controls)를 도입하여 에이전트의 기능과 민감한 데이터에 대한 접근을 더 세밀하게 관리할 수 있도록 할 것입니다. 이는 보안과 컴플라이언스가 중요한 엔터프라이즈 배포에 필수적입니다.

고급 검색 도구인 InfoQuest 지능형 검색 툴킷의 통합은 ByteDance가 에이전트의 다양한 비정형 소스에서 정보를 검색하고 처리하는 능력을 개선하는 데 집중하고 있음을 시사합니다. 이는 에이전트의 연구 및 분석 능력을 향상시킬 것입니다. 또한, DeerFlow 2.0이 기존 데이터베이스, CRM 시스템, ERP 플랫폼과 원활하게 상호작용할 수 있는 능력은 조직의 핵심 비즈니스 프로세스에 AI 에이전트를 통합하려는 기업들에게 주요 차별점이 될 것입니다. 이를 통해 여러 부서와 기능을 아우르는 종단 간 자동화 워크플로우를 생성하여 상당한 효율성 향상을 이끌 수 있습니다.

AI 자동화에 집중하는 개발자와 엔지니어들에게 DeerFlow 2.0은 에이전트 기술의 최전선에 머물기 위한 가치 있는 자원이 됩니다. 그 오픈소스 특성은 커뮤니티 기여와 혁신을 장려하며 프레임워크의 진화를 가속화하는 협력적 환경을 조성합니다. AI 에이전트 생태계가 성숙해짐에 따라 DeerFlow 2.0은 다음 세대의 자율형 애플리케이션을 구축하기 위한 핵심 도구로 자리매김할 것입니다. 신뢰성, 보안, 확장성에 대한 강조는 업계의 성장하는 요구와 부합하므로, AI 기반 자동화와 지능형 협업의 미래에 관심 있는 이들에게 모니터링하고 참여할 만한 프레임워크입니다.

Sources